Nagaraj Shetti, Senior Technical Research Analyst at HDFC Securities
Nifty witnessed a decent bounce back on Wednesday after the sharp weakness of Tuesday and closed the day higher by 166 points. After opening with a positive note, the market continued its gradual upside momentum for better part of the session. Intraday dips in between have been bought into and Nifty closed at the highs.
A long bull candle was formed on the daily chart that placed within a high low range of Tuesday's long bear candle. Technically, this market action indicates a formation of inside day bar or bullish harami type candle pattern. This is bullish formation and follow-through upmove from here could confirm this as a reversal pattern.
Wednesday's market action signal possible formation of higher bottom at 23136 levels. However, tomorrow's event of US President Donald Trump's tariff decision on India could possibly result in extreme opening of Indian markets on Thursday, on either side. Immediate support is at 23100 and the next overhead resistance to be watched at 23400 and 23650 levels respectively.

Ajit Mishra – SVP, Research, Religare Broking
Markets rebounded after Tuesday’s decline, gaining over half a percent. Following a flat opening, Nifty edged higher and remained range-bound throughout the session, eventually closing at 23,332.35. Most key sectors contributed to the recovery, with realty, FMCG, and banking leading the gains. Meanwhile, broader indices continued their outperformance, rising nearly one and a half percent each.
Markets will react to the announcement of reciprocal tariffs and the initial response from global markets, which could influence sentiment. Additionally, the scheduled weekly expiry may add to the volatility.
We recommend a cautious stance and favor a hedged approach until there is greater clarity on the index’s next directional move. However, stocks continue to offer trading opportunities on both sides, and participants should position themselves accordingly.

Market Close | Nifty above 23,300, Sensex rises 593 pts ahead of Trump's tariffs
Indian equity indices ended higher on April 2 with Nifty above 23,300.
At close, the Sensex was up 592.93 points or 0.78 percent at 76,617.44, and the Nifty was up 166.65 points or 0.72 percent at 23,332.35. About 2755 shares advanced, 1049 shares declined, and 130 shares unchanged.
All the sectoral indices ended in the green with FMCG, Consumer Durables, Realty up 1-3 percent.
BSE Midcap and smallcap indices rose nearly 1 percent each.
Tata Consumer, Zomato, Titan Company, IndusInd Bank, Maruti Suzuki were among major gainers on the Nifty, while losers were Bharat Electronics, UltraTech Cement, Nestle India, Power Grid Corp and L&T.

Anuj Choudhary – Research Analyst at Mirae Asset Sharekhan
Indian Rupee declined today on uncertainty over trade tariffs and FII outflows. Surge in crude oil prices also put pressure on the Rupee. However, positive domestic markets and weak tone in the US Dollar cushioned the downside. India’s manufacturing PMI expanded to 58.10 in March vs forecast of 57.60.
We expect Rupee to trade with a positive bias on trade tariff uncertainty and worries over rising crude oil prices. However, foreign inflows and positive domestic markets may support rupee at lower levels. Traders may take cues from ADP non farm employment and factory orders data from the US. USDINR spot price is expected to trade in a range of Rs 85.3 to Rs 85.85.

Sensex Today | Bharat Dynamics achieves turnover of over Rs 3300 crore in FY 2024-25
Bharat Dynamics has achieved turnover of over Rs 3300 crore (Provisional & Unaudited) during the FY 2024-25, against the previous year’s turnover of Rs 2369 crore registering a record growth of around 40%.
This includes, highest ever export turnover of over Rs 1200 crore (Provisional & Unaudited) during FY 2024-25 as against the previous year’s export turnover of Rs 161 crore, registering a record growth of over 640%.

Brokerage Call | Morgan Stanley keeps ‘overweight’ rating on Coal India, target price at Rs 525
#1 March 2025 off-take remained under pressure, flat YoY
#2 Power demand improved from Feb, trending up at 6-7 percent YoY
#3 CIL volumes struggled due to elevated power plant inventories (over 19 days)
#4 Expect some digestion as power demand remains strong, but off-take may remain pressured in Q1
#5 Weak off-take & global coal price pressures may impact Q4FY25 & FY26 earnings unless power demand picks up significantly
